BJ's Wholesale Club 1Q26 Earnings First Take
Single Stock ReportEquitiesConsumer Staples
BJ's Wholesale Club reported a 1Q26 earnings beat with adj. EPS of $1.10, despite same-store sales growth of 1.5% falling short of estimates. The company reiterated its FY26 guidance and saw strong membership income growth.
Key Takeaways
- 1.BJ reported 1Q26 adjusted EPS of $1.10 and EBIT of $208mn, both beating GS and consensus estimates despite a slight miss in same-store sales.
- 2.Comparable club sales (SSS ex-gas) grew 1.5%, which was lower than the expected 2.0%.
- 3.Membership Fee Income (MFI) saw strong growth of 9.9% year-over-year, reflecting a solid membership base.
